Solid’ Opener to OBS Spring

by Jessica Martini and J.M. Severni The Ocala Breeders’ Sales Company’s Spring Sale of 2-Year-Olds in Training, which enjoyed record-setting renewals in 2013 and 2014, got off to a measured start Tuesday in Ocala. With 163 horses selling for $9,642,700, the average fell 7.9% to $59,158, while the median was up 5% to $42,000. A...

Mount Athos Future Uncertain

Globetrotting group winner Mount Athos (Ire) (Montjeu {Ire}) faces an uncertain future on the racetrack after trainer Marco Botti revealed Wednesday the 8-year-old gelding could be retired. The Marwan Koukash silkbearer, who has not been seen since winning the Listed Aston Park S. almost a year ago, was being readied for the May 8 G3 Ormonde S.,...

Ward’s Ascot Arsenal Gains Strength

Wesley Ward’s already formidable team for Royal Ascot has been further strengthened with the addition of G1 winner Big Macher (Beau Genius) to his stable. Previously trained by Richard Baltas to win the G1 Bing Crosby Handicap at Del Mar last July and last seen running creditably in the G1 Golden Shaheen S. on Dubai World Cup...
